Location

The hotel is located next to San Jerónimo monastery and San Juan de Dios hospital, approximately 5 minutes from the cathedral and the royal chapel. The hotel is ideally located in the historical and commercial centre of Granada, easily reached by car, train or bus. Restaurants are to be found right outside the hotel, whilst bars, restaurants and nightclubs are 500 m away, the train station is 1 km away and the bus station is 3.5 km from the hotel. Màlaga airport lies approximately 15 km away and a ski area is 35 km from the hotel.

Facility

2 single rooms and 28 double rooms are located on 5 storeys and can be reached by lift. English- and French-speaking staff at the 24-hour reception desk are happy to answer any questions. Amenities available at the hotel include a cloakroom, a baggage storage service and a safe. Wireless internet access in public areas allows guests to stay connected. The tour desk offers assistance with booking excursions. The hotel has wheelchair-accessible facilities. Parking spaces are available to guests travelling by car. Further services include a 24-hour security service, room service and a laundry service. Bicycles can be kept in the bicycle storage area.

Rooms

Air conditioning and individually adjustable heating ensure that rooms maintain comfortable temperatures. A balcony is among the standard features of some rooms. Rooms have a double bed or a queen-size bed. Extra beds can be requested. A safe and a desk are also available. An ironing set is provided for guests' convenience. A direct dial telephone, a television with satellite/cable channels and WiFi (no extra charge) are provided as well. Guests can take advantage of the nightly turndown service. Bathrooms are equipped with a shower and a bathtub, as well as a hairdryer. The hotel has 30 non-smoking rooms.

    We spent New Year’s Eve here. I must have been expecting a bit more “old world” ambience. The room was typically on the smaller side-standard for touristy European towns. Rhe bathroom was quite big. The breakfast was limited but adequate, The area was just okay. Don’t stay here (in the area) if you’re looking to walk around the antique Granada of Gypsy lore. They offer parking for an extra fee in a lot down the block. The view of the Monastary is lovely-just as the posted photos depict.

    This small hotel is well located being less than 10 mins walk to the cathedral but in need of some refurbishment. Our room faced the monastery (a visit is highly recommended) but we were regularly disturbed at night by loud voices in the street even though our window was closed and we had secondary glazing. Staff were very helpful when we needed to find a plug for the basin and bath as both were missing.
